Köra massor av knappar
Detta projekt kom eftersom jag försökte att tänka på det bästa sättet att använda indata från ett stort antal knappar, samtidigt som det krävs det minsta antalet Arduino stift. Jag började med underbar handledning på Arduino platsen visar hur man använda indata från en knapp (se: https://www.arduino.cc/en/Tutorial/Button). Det finns också ett antal execllent Instructables som visar smarta sätt att kombinera flera knappar med motstånd så du behöver bara en Arduino pin.
Men var mitt mål att kunna upptäcka knapptryckningar från dussintals knappar, och de flesta av tutorials ovan var begränsad i antalet knappar de kunde adress. Dessutom märkte jag att många av dem inte var kan upptäcka flera samtidiga knapptryckningar, som var en annan funktion jag ville stödja.